Key Responsibilities

  • Partner with eCommerce team on launch of new site features, focusing on testing and measurement plan to determine impact.
  • Ensure tagging and analytics implementation (in collaboration with the dev team) support accurate tracking of user actions.
  • Analyze onsite and in-app behavior to identify friction points and optimization opportunities across the purchase journey.
  • Share insights from ad hoc and post launch analyses with eCommerce team in weekly standing meeting.
  • Collaborate with eCommerce team on developing hypotheses from these insights to form a robust testing and optimization roadmap.
  • Provide post promo & personalization campaign insights on how key marketing and media initiatives impact site or app behavior and recommend optimizations to meet both short and long-term goals.
  • Own the framing, design, duration and analysis of A/B, multivariate & personalization tests across both the website and app.
  • Assess feasibility of proposed tests in partnership with the Dev team.
  • Ensure tagging and analytics implementation (in collaboration with the Dev team) support accurate tracking of testing outcomes.
  • Build and maintain library of test set ups and results to ensure continuous improvement on known insights.
  • Provide clear, data-driven recommendations to improve site / app customer experience and drive increased conversion, engagement and (when measurable) brand loyalty.
  • Partner with CX, eCommerce, and broader Data & Insights teams to create and execute on-site and in-app optimization roadmap that supports broader CX initiatives.
  • Support integration of lift calculations into forecasting and planning cycle processes.
  • Work to align with HQ on the development and implementation of aligned AB Testing best practices.
  • Own weekly, monthly, and campaign-specific reporting and dashboard creation for web and app performance, focusing on conversion, funnel behavior, engagement, and revenue metrics.
  • Champion self-service usage of BI reporting tool, ensuring proper training and confidence in data for stakeholders.
  • Share learnings, best practices, and data needs with analytics counterparts in HQ and other markets to drive continuous improvement for the U.S.
  • Partner with Data Capabilities team on data quality and accuracy for reporting and to prioritize data requirements for expanding use cases.
  • Work with team members to drive consistency & excellence in deliverables.
  • Develop team skill sets and manage their workload effectively.
  • Ensure projects are prioritized and tied to larger business strategy.
  • Champion a culture of experimentation, learning, and iteration across teams.
  • Develop and own implementation of long-term digital analytics roadmap.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's Degree in Analytics, Statistics, Mathematics, Computer Science or similar field is required.
  • Master's Degree is preferred but not required.
  • At least 5 years of advanced analytics with at least 2 years of people leadership experience is a must.
  • 2 or more years of experience working with on-site A/B testing and in an ecommerce environment is required.
  • Combination of experience across Google Analytics, Adobe, GTM, data visualization tools, SQL, Big Query, Python, R, SQL or similar tools is required.

Nice to Have

  • Experience with developing and implementing digital analytics roadmaps.
  • Experience in a global or cross-market environment.
  • Knowledge of digital marketing and media impact analysis.
